Object of the Game:
Be the
first player to make three 3 or 4-letter words.
Set Up:
Separate
the vowel cards (green cards with blue letters) from the consonant cards
(orange cards with red letters). Stack the green cards face-down in the
center of the table. Deal out all the orange cards to the players.
Players start with 3 orange cards in their hands and stack the rest of
their orange cards face-down to their right (this is their draw pile).
Game Play:
One
player turns the top green vowel card face-up in the center of the table
and says, "Go!" All players simultaneously try to make a 3 or 4-letter
word using their orange cards and the green card in the center. If a
player cannot make a word, he discards one orange card to his left, and
takes a new orange card from his draw pile. He continues drawing and
discarding until he can make a word. Players may not have more than 3
orange cards in their hand at any time. If a player can make a word, he
takes the green card from the center and immediately turns over the next
green card. Then he sets all the cards used to make his word aside,
draws new orange cards, and continues playing. All players are drawing
and discarding at the same time – as fast as they can. If a player’s
draw pile runs out, he draws cards from the player on his right’s
discard pile. Players yell "snap" as they take the green card to make
their first word, "it" when they make their second, and "up" when they
make their third. All play stops when one player yells "up." Then that
player shows the three words he made. If the words are spelled
correctly, he wins! If any word is incorrect, the green vowel card from
that word is returned to the center pile and play continues.
Wild Card:
This
card may be used to represent any orange consonant card a player
chooses.
Variation:
For
greater variety and challenge, try turning over 3 green vowel cards
while players try to make 4-letter words.
Simplified Game Play:
Do not
include green “y” vowel cards for this version. Play is similar to
above, but instead of passing the orange cards out, they are spread out
face-down in a circle around the stack of green cards. Each player takes
one green vowel card and places it face up in front of him. Each player
will use his own green card to make words. One player says, "go" and all
players draw 3 orange cards and try to make words. If a player can’t
make a word, he discards one orange card by returning it face-down to
the circle of cards, and draws a new orange card. Players may not have
more than 3 orange cards in their hand at a time.
If a
player makes a word, he sets the word aside and draws a new green vowel
card. Players continue drawing and discarding, trying to make three
words. Players yell "snap," "it," and "up" as they make each word.
